The Omega J8006 Nutrition Center is a masticating style juicer. Sometimes referred to as a low speed juicer, the Nutrition Center processes at 80rpm, whereas most other juicers process at a speed of 1,650 to 15,000rpm. The low speed protects and maintains healthy enzymes, prevents oxidation and allows juice to be stored up to 72 hours without degradation. The GE Ultem Auger is 8x stronger than most other plastics and the powerful gear reduction is equivalent to a 2HP Motor. The dual stage juice processing system extracts the maximum amount of juice from fruits, vegetables, leafy greens, even wheatgrass!   • Juicer processes at 80rpm’s. Low speed or masticating style juicer squeezes, instead of grinding, which allows the juice to maintain its pure color, natural taste, vitamins and nutrients.
  • Dual stage juicer. First, juice is extracted by crushing the fruit or vegetable. Then, before the pulp is ejected, the pulp is squeezed during the second pressed stage. This results in a higher yield of juice and a very dry pulp.

  1. Rusty

    Found this to be a pragmatic and workable solution to making decent juices…
    -Sturdy, with the result that one can drop firm fruits and veggies in with impunity.
    -two front-end elements, one for juicing and one for making more viscous products, like nut butters
    -given the number of moving parts, is relatively easy to assemble/disassemble and clean. Two “hubs” lock and unlock the key moving parts which then disassemble with a bit of “muscle action”. The lock/unlock hubs are the secret behind making this a relatively easy deal to pull apart and then reassemble.
    -To date, I have just cleaned the parts manually, then allowing to dry on the counter. The filter which takes the brunt of the juicing action is the most challenging; a brush is included, but I find that pre-soaking to get the embedded pulp as mushy as possible helps a bit.
    -For the juicing spigot, there is a secondary filter that one can place into the receiving bowl. For purists, that grabs the final bit of pulp that may have gotten through, for the non-purist, one can not use it. My “middle ground” is to tamp the viscous liquid a bit with the tamper, getting the juice that can flow through the screen into the bowl. Yep, results in some fiber in the juice.
    -Not as noisy as I was expecting
    -the one challenge is learning how to slice and feed the chute. The feeding tube is relatively narrow, requiring some care in slicing product for insertion. I find it helps to follow soft stuff with hard stuff – lemon followed by carrot… as the firm stuff tends to drive through the system with greater ease.
    The end result – with a moderate amount of care and effort – are juice products that are blended and as pulp-free as you want without excessive effort.
